Finding Starlight: A Small Town, Romantic Suspense (The Quimby Grove Series Book 1) Kindle Edition

4.0 4.0 out of 5 stars 143 ratings

A woman looking to escape her past.
A man returning to his roots.
And someone just beneath the surface, watching their every move...

Quimby Grove, Pennsylvania is the perfect place for a fresh start. After leaving her old life behind, Ellawyn Calloway is finally able to breathe a little easier. She spends all her time at Starlight Books, a quaint bookstore café, and develops a friendship with the elderly shop owner, Benji.

But everything changes when Benji requests that his grandson, Beckett Walden, return to Quimby Grove for a visit. When Ellawyn learns of a devastating threat to Starlight Books, she doesn't think twice, offering to help Beckett run the store.

Ellawyn finds herself letting her guard down piece by piece. But as those walls fade away, an unwanted presence finds a way to slip through the cracks and into Ellawyn’s life. With a stalker on the prowl, Ellawyn is in more danger than she ever imagined.

Through tragedy, Ellawyn and Beckett begin to find love within each other, both oblivious to the real danger that is lurking in the shadows, desperate to get Ellawyn alone.

Reviewed in the United States on June 8, 2022
This is a quaint, small-town contemporary romance. It does contain some heavy topics so if cancer, death, stalking and assault are triggers for you this is not the right pick for you!

Pros:

Starting the book reminded me of starting one of my favorite Nora Roberts books, Dance Upon the Air. The main characters in both stories break out of abusive situations to find refuge in a small town bookstore, befriending the owner and sharing their art.

Benji was a gem and I could have really enjoyed more time with him. Same with Max whom I think will have his own story soon (if I’m picking up the right vibes)!

Cons:

Someone shy and nervous about touch and being noticed wouldn’t be comfortable having an orgasm in a store with big windows that anyone could see through. Setting this as the first intimate encounter of the main couple kind of grossed me out. Not because it was gross but because it didn’t fit the setting or characters as I believed I knew them.

I understand a budding romance, but it is irresponsible to leave someone who was just released from the hospital alone for several hours let alone over night. We know Benji had side effect and was struggling, if he had a seizure or his headache worsened to the point of danger he might not be able to call anyone for help. Beckett is too responsible so this seems like a major oversight and I can only image it was added because of the romance.

Why would Beckett have his own house when he isn’t been in town for two years? This makes me question things even more on the care or lack thereof being given Benji. It angers me because it doesn’t make sense. I would never leave someone alone after surgery any longer than running out to grab a prescription or some last minute supply to make them more comfortable. Maybe I’m the odd one in how I care for people but it did make me lose some respect for Beckett and Ellawyn.

Angela Hayes
4.0 out of 5 stars Debut novel...
Reviewed in Australia on June 8, 2022
4 Stars

First of all, can we please take a moment to appreciate the beautiful cover for this book. It is what drew me to this book, and I had one-clicked myself a copy before I even knew anything else about it. Yes, I know a am a sucker for a beautiful cover. Sometimes it is a hit and miss situation- but luckily this book made it on to the hit list.
Finding Starlight is the first book in the Quimby Grove series and debut novel by Shannon Nikole. I was surprised to find that this was the author’s debut novel, as it is quite well-woven. She is an author to watch out for going forward, because if this is what she can produce as a debut, I can only imagine what riveting reads she will deliver in the future.
This combines suspense and emotion really well. A story about seeking a fresh start, making friends, connections, romance, stalker danger, steam, tension, and dramatic developments. Add in a quaint little bookstore, a lovely friendship, and some tragedy- and this story definitely tugged on the heartstrings.
While there were moments where I felt like the story lagged, or seemed to skim over details I would have liked to know more about, while expanding on other (less important?) details, and such- I put it down to maybe being teething issues from being a first novel, and as such, I look forward to following this author to see what book #2, and other future releases, might hold.
